首页 科普 正文

电商平台北京空间

科普 编辑:书宝 日期:2024-04-22 01:14:19 329人浏览

电商平台的架构优化是如今众多企业都在努力探索的话题。北京作为我国的政治、文化和经济中心城市,拥有国内众多的知名电商企业。在面对竞争激烈的市场环境下,优化电商平台的架构将有利于提升用户购物体验、减少平台维护成本、加快业务迭代速度等方面。因此,今天我们将来探讨一下北京电商平台架构优化的相关问题。

一、架构优化的意义

1. 提升用户购物体验

电商平台的用户购物体验,直接影响着其购买意愿与忠诚度。因此,如何打造一个流畅、快捷、安全的购物平台,是电商平台优化架构的重要目标。通过优化架构,加强平台的负载能力、稳定性、安全性以及响应速度,可以大幅提升用户的购物体验,提高其满意度和忠诚度,从而增加交易量和用户留存率。

2. 减少平台维护成本

平台的架构优化可以有效降低平台运营成本。一方面,通过中间件、云计算技术等方式,可以节省服务器设备、机房租用等硬件支出;另一方面,通过优化代码质量、优化数据库访问、采用分布式架构等方式,可以降低开发人员的时间成本和人力成本,从而减少平台的维护成本。

3. 加快业务迭代速度

电商平台的竞争非常激烈,因此不断地推陈出新、引领潮流是非常重要的。通过架构优化,可以建立业务模块化,实现快速迭代,降低业务上线时间,提高业务响应速度,提升企业在市场竞争中的竞争力。

二、架构优化的方法

1. 引入中间件

中间件是指介于应用程序和操作系统之间的软件系统,可以提供诸如负载均衡、缓存、消息队列等服务。在电商平台中,引入中间件可以有效的提升平台的性能和稳定性。比如可以引入Redis作为缓存系统,可以大幅度的缩短系统读取数据的时间,从而提升性能;可以引入Kafka作为消息队列,实现异步处理,提升平台的可用性和响应速度。

2. 采用分布式架构

采用分布式架构可以很好地解决高并发和大流量的问题。通过将平台的功能划分为多个子系统,并采用分布式架构的方式部署,可以实现系统的横向扩展和负载均衡。比如可以采用分布式缓存Redis Sentinel,将缓存系统做成分布式,避免单点故障;还可以采用分布式数据库MySQL Cluster,提升平台的负载能力和稳定性。

3. 优化数据库访问

优化数据库访问是电商平台优化架构的关键之一。电商平台的数据量很大,访问频率也很高,因此优化数据库访问可以大幅提升系统的性能和稳定性。比如可以对数据库进行垂直拆分,将不同的业务分散到不同的数据库中,降低数据冗余和复杂度;还可以对数据库进行水平拆分,将数据分散到不同的数据库实例中,实现负载均衡。

电商平台北京空间

三、总结

电商平台架构的优化可以提升用户的购物体验、减少平台维护成本、加快业务迭代速度等方面的表现。在北京这样的电商大城市,企业需要结合自身业务需求和竞争环境,选用合适的方案进行架构优化。引入中间件、采用分布式架构、优化数据库访问等优化措施可以很好地提高平台的性能和稳定性。

分享到

文章已关闭评论!